The Yanks got Hairston from Cincy for ML catcher Chase Weems. Hairston seems to be a very good utility player, can play really any position, infield or outfield. I know nothing about Weems (nykgeneralmanager?), but it seems like a deal that can't hurt us.
Not a pithcer, but he is an upgrade and it seems like it will signal the end of Cody Ransom.

Weems looked to be more of a prospect a couple of years ago when the position was our weakest, now it is arguably our strongest. He's kind of like Cervelli, probably even better defensively but he just isn't nearly as close to being major league ready and his bat is really really raw. He used to have a decent spot on the organizational depth chart, but guys like Montero and Romine have obviously become top prospects and even guys like Anson and Higashioka have surpassed him as fillers. I don't think he had a chance to reach the majors with the Yanks.
